
If you're looking to purchase Dr. Remedy nail polish in stores, you have several options to explore. Major retailers such as CVS, Walgreens, and Rite Aid often carry Dr. Remedy products in their beauty or nail care sections, making it convenient for customers to find them during their regular shopping trips. Additionally, specialty beauty stores like Ulta Beauty and Sally Beauty Supply frequently stock Dr. Remedy nail polishes, offering a wider selection and expert advice. For those who prefer shopping at department stores, chains like Macy's and Dillard's may also have Dr. Remedy products available. Always check the store’s website or call ahead to confirm availability, as inventory can vary by location. Alternatively, you can visit Dr. Remedy’s official website or authorized online retailers like Amazon for a broader range of options and the convenience of home delivery.

Specialty Foot Care Retailers
When searching for Dr. Remedy nail polish in stores, one of the most reliable options is to visit Specialty Foot Care Retailers. These stores are dedicated to providing products specifically designed for foot health and wellness, making them an ideal place to find Dr. Remedy’s podiatrist-formulated nail polishes. Unlike general beauty stores, specialty foot care retailers prioritize items that address common foot concerns, such as fungal infections, brittle nails, or sensitivity, which aligns perfectly with Dr. Remedy’s mission. Brands like Dr. Remedy are often featured prominently in these stores due to their focus on both aesthetics and nail health.
To locate a Specialty Foot Care Retailer near you, start by searching online directories or using store locators on the Dr. Remedy website. Many of these retailers are independently owned or part of regional chains, so they may not always appear in mainstream search results. However, they are often recommended by podiatrists and foot care professionals, making them a trusted source for Dr. Remedy products. Stores like The Foot Care Shop, Foot Solutions, or Healthy Feet Store are examples of specialty retailers that frequently carry Dr. Remedy nail polish.
